Wolf Pack volleyball wins fourth SSAC match Thursday

The Loyola Wolf Pack improved their conference record to 4-1 Thursday night, defeating Florida College in straight sets

NEW ORLEANS – The Loyola University New Orleans volleyball team made quick work of Florida College Thursday in The Den, moving its conference record to 4-1 with a straight-sets win (25-15, 25-20, 25-23) over the Lady Falcons. 

 

Loyola is now 6-5 overall this season, and the Wolf Pack will finish a five-game homestand Saturday when they host Brewton-Parker at 3:30 p.m.

 

The Wolf Pack got six kills in the early going of the first set, jumping out to a 10-6 lead en route to a 25-15 set win. After Florida College got to within two, 10-8, Jordan Bernard tallied back-to-back kills to extend the score to 13-8. The Wolf Pack held at least a four-point lead for the rest of the set, and Jules Mokry finished off the opening game with two late kills. 

 

Loyola got off to another hot start in Set 2, taking a 7-2 lead after a couple of blocks from Casey Aucoin, two kills from Bernard and another kill from Brittany Cooper. Aucoin, Mokry and Bernard each found the floor to push Loyola's lead to 11-7, then Emily Sheperis and Kailyn O'Neal got in on the action to make it a 16-10 lead. Cooper tallied back-to-back kills and Aucoin got her second of the set to fend off the Lady Falcons' late run, 21-16. Bernard and Sheperis each had two kills to close out the set, 25-20, and help the Wolf Pack grab control of the match, 2-0. 

 

The dramatics were saved for the third and final set, as the Wolf Pack fought from behind to finish the sweep with a 25-23 third-set win. Loyola started the third set with a 5-0 lead, but the Lady Falcons clawed back to tie the set at 11-11. The Wolf Pack, again, fell behind, but Cooper tied the game at 17-17 with another kill. The Plano, Texas, native then got two more kills to put Loyola back on top 20-19, and Aucoin extended the score to 22-19 moments later before she finished the match with two more attacks in the final three points.

 

Wolf Pack Head Coach Jesse Zabal

"It was great to get another home and conference win tonight. Brittany had a strong game, both offensively and defensively. Kailyn and Gracie continue to spread the ball to all of our attackers and Jordan, Casey, and Emily were very efficient on offense. Florida College made some smart adjustments that challenged us a bit in the third set, but we're proud of the team's fight and focus to finish the match in three. We're looking forward to one more home match on Saturday before we start the second half of our conference schedule." 

Pack Facts

  • Brittany Cooper used a season-best .400 hit percentage to collect a team-high nine kills. Cooper also led the Wolf Pack with 11 digs. 

  • Emily Sheperis and Jordan Bernard each had eight kills to help Loyola's diverse attack. Casey Aucoin and Jules Mokry added six kills each as well. 

  • Helene Masone was second on the team with 10 digs, marking the 26th straight game with double-digit digs. 

  • Gracie Bailey and Kailyn O'Neal both reached double figures in assists in the same match for the 9th time this season. Bailey had 13 and O'Neal had 15.

  • It's the second straight season Loyola has started SSAC play 4-1. Prior to last season, Loyola hadn't accomplished that feat since the 2010 season.
